Rotorua's parade was rained on too but not completely. The annual New Year's Eve Rock The Lake Mardi Gras had to be moved to the Rotorua Energy Events Centre - the first time it has had to move in 16 years because of bad weather.
Sure, the crowd numbers were down but the 4000 people who did attend were treated to a top show.
We are lucky in Rotorua to have such a great indoor venue that could be used as a backup. Congratulations to Monty Morrison and his team for putting in the extra effort rather than pulling the pin.
